The roots … Web17 feb. 2024 · For single crown plants, the pot size recommendations are determined by the type of plant you are growing. For a Standard African Violet, use a pot that is 3” to 4” in diameter. For a Dwarf/Mini African Violets, use a pot that is 1” to 2” in diameter. WebPots for African Violets are available in increments of roughly one inch. Therefore, if you have an African Violet which is currently in a 2-inch pot, you will want to repot it in a 3-inch pot. Web29 sep. 2024 · What size pot is best for African violets? Overpotting will delay bloom. The usual recommendation is that the pot diameter should be one-third the spread of the leaf span. For example. if the plant’s leaves measure 9 inches from one leaf tip to the opposite leaf tip, use a 3-inch pot. Violets bloom best when they are potbound.
